  • What is the cheapest day to fly to Maryland?

    Based on KAYAK data, the cheapest day to fly to Maryland is Saturday where round-trip tickets can be as cheap as $240. On the other hand, the most expensive day to fly is Wednesday, where round-trip prices are $371 on average.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Maryland?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Maryland is generally in the morning, when round-trip flights cost $293 on average. Morning departures are around 19%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Maryland is generally in the afternoon,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$482.

  • What is the cheapest month to fly from British Columbia to Maryland?

    The cheapest month for flights from British Columbia to Maryland is January, when tickets cost $289 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are May and December,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$431 and $422 respectively.

  • How far in advance should I book a flight from British Columbia to Maryland?

    To get a below average price on the flight from British Columbia to Maryland, you should book around 3 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 15 weeks before departure.

  • How long is the flight to Maryland?

    An average nonstop flight from British Columbia to Maryland takes 10h 02m, covering a distance of 2230 miles. The shortest route is Calgary (YYC) to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port (IAD) with an average flight time of 4h 20m.
